Getting Approved



If your application to the property was approved, you can enroll for Rhino coverage. Rhino does a soft credit check to help determine pricing. This credit check does not affect your score.

What is a rhino application?

Rhinoceros (typically abbreviated Rhino or Rhino3D) is a commercial 3D computer graphics and computer-aided design (CAD) application software that was developed by Robert McNeel & Associates, an American, privately held, and employee-owned company that was founded in 1980.

How does the rhino program work?

Rhino is security deposit insurance. Instead of paying the security deposit amount in cash at the time of the lease — renters pay a monthly fee to Rhino, averaging $5-10 a month — to cover the security deposit. Using Rhino frees up renters’ cash so that they can afford renters insurance and other moving expenses.

Do you get Rhino back?

Do I get my payments back at the end of the lease like a security deposit? Rhino replaces the need for a large security deposit and your low monthly payments are not refunded at the end of your lease. Rhino fulfills the same requirement as a deposit, but at a fraction of the cost.

Do Apartment credit checks affect credit score?

Since most credit checks for renting are considered soft checks, they won’t negatively impact your credit score. The FICO® credit-scoring model, one of the most popular credit scores, ignores inquiries made within 30 days of scoring.

What can Rhino 3D do?

Overview. Rhino can create, edit, analyze, document, render, animate, and translate NURBS curves, surfaces and solids, subdivision geometry (SubD), point clouds, and polygon meshes. There are no limits on complexity, degree, or size beyond those of your hardware.
